About Pablo J SantaMaria, MD, FACS
Dr. SantaMaria joined Augusta Health on July 1, 2020 after 23 years of community practice in Middle and South Georgia where he be came one of the busiest urological stone surgeons in the USA. He has treated patients in large metropolitan centers, resort communities and rural settings. He has served on local, state and national committees. He eagerly brings his diverse life and clinical experiences to teach the urologist of the future as he cares for the patients of today.
